Regards, Michael From: Claus Ibsen <claus.ib...@gmail.com> Sent: Thursday, June 13, 2019 1:13 PM To: users@camel.apache.org Subject: Re: Intermittent RejectedExecutionException Hi I would try with just <to> and set a header with the dynamic destination (CamelJmsDestinationOverride) or something like that, check the docs/source code, then you use a static sender.
